免疫磁性分选骨髓干细胞亚群Thy-1low Lin- Sca-1+
Isolation and purification of Thy-1low Lin- Sca-1+ bone marrow stem subset cells by magnetic activated cell sorting
【摘要】 目的 采用免疫磁性细胞分选系统 (MACS)分离纯化骨髓干细胞亚群Thy 1lowLin Sca 1+ 。方法 收集小鼠股骨骨髓细胞 ,用MACS系统 ,通过三步分选步骤选择Thy 1lowSca 1+ 细胞 ,去除Lin+ 细胞 ,得骨髓干细胞亚群Thy 1lowLin Sca 1+ ,流式细胞仪分析其纯度 ,计算回收率。结果 分选出的Thy 1lowLin Sca 1+ 细胞纯度和回收率分别为 72 .3 6% ,82 .43 % ,达到MACS分选CD3 4+ 细胞水平。结论 MACS系统能有效分选骨髓干细胞亚群Thy 1lowLin Sca 1+ ,纯度和回收率高。
【Abstract】 Objective To isolate and purify Thy 1 low Lin Sca 1 + bone marrow stem subset cells by magnetic activated cell sorting(MACS). Methods Thy 1 low Lin Sca 1 + cells from mouse bone marrow were collected through three processes by MACS.After Lin + cells were removed,Thy 1 low Lin Sca 1 + bone marrow stem cell subsets were harvasted.The purity of the cells was analysed by FACS and the reclaimation rate was counted. Results The purity and reclaimation rate of Thy 1 low Lin Sca 1 + cells were 72.36% and 82.43% respectively, which equaled to the level of isolation and purification of CD34 + cells by MACS. Conclusions It is effective to isolate and purify Thy 1 low Lin Sca 1 + bone marrow stem cell subsets by MACS, and the purity and reclaimation rate of the cells are high.
